免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发的ui设计要求

随着智能手机的普及,如今有越来越多的人开始使用手机来访问网站和使用各种应用程序。为此,同时也出现了越来越多的应用程序。如何能够在众多的应用程序中脱颖而出,成为用户的首选呢?UI设计就变得至关重要。在本文中,我们将介绍App开发的UI设计要求的原理和详细介绍。

什么是UI设计?

UI就是界面设计(User Interface),在互联网领域指的是用户界面设计,即为用户提供友好的操作界面和易于使用的体验。一款优秀的UI设计可以提高用户体验,吸引更多的用户,并增加用户对应用程序的满意程度和忠诚度。

一个成功的UI设计需要做什么?

一、界面设计必须符合用户习惯和心理,让用户感觉舒适。

在应用程序开发中,界面必须能以用户为中心,符合用户的心理和习惯,让用户感觉舒适。UI的设计要考虑到用户的使用习惯和心理,让用户在使用过程中的体验更加舒适自然,并且让用户在最短的时间内通过UI来完成操作。

二、简化操作步骤,更加高效自然。

原则上,每个按钮和操作都应该被设计得尽可能简单,便于用户理解和记忆,这样可以最大程度地减少学习成本,提高用户体验。其次,UI的设计应该给用户一种直观、自然的感觉,让用户可以快速的完成相关的操作,呈现流畅自然的动画效果,让用户感受到操作的高效。

三、尽可能地减少干扰,让用户聚焦主题。

UI设计的原则是要尽最大努力减少用户的干扰,并使用户能够专注于目标内容。当用户使用应用程序时,应用程序的设计应该让用户聚焦在最重要的内容上,而不是被其他无关的内容所占据。在设计UI界面时,应该考虑让用户可以集中注意力在最关键的内容上。

四、统一风格,增加品牌辨识度。

UI设计必须对应用程序的品牌提供一种统一的风格和风格指南。一个良好的品牌形象可以打造应用程序的不断增长和长期生存。 在UI设计中,需要考虑到各种元素的风格并将它们整合进来,使UI界面看上去更加协调,有利于增加品牌的辨识度和品牌的建立。

五、注重交互,在完成操作的同时给用户良好的反馈。

UI设计需要注重交互的过程,并在完成操作的同时给用户一个良好的反馈。不论是滑动、缩放、拖拽在内的各种手势操作,在UI界面上都应该能够给予良好的反馈,而这种反馈可以是视觉、声音、震动等等方式,能够增强用户对使用体验的感受,并且能够让用户更好地理解他们所做的事情。

六、关注可辨识度,界面要有良好的可视性

为了使应用程序易于理解和使用,UI设计必须具有良好的可辨识度。UI需要通过样式、颜色、图标、文字等元素去表达信息,并帮助用户理解应用程序的不同部分的功能。在UI设计中,对于每个元素应有明确和相对应的视觉表达方式,有助于用户对不同的元素进行较为准确的理解和记忆。

总结:

以上所提述的六个原则,是App开发的UI设计要求的重点,UI设计的好坏直接影响到使用体验,从而影响了用户对App的好感度和忠诚度。因此,为了提高应用程序的使用价值和信任感,UI设计一定要做到简单易懂、符合人性化、操作简便、结构清晰等。


相关知识:
厦门app开发常见问题
随着移动互联网的快速发展,APP已经成为了人们日常生活中必不可少的应用之一。而APP开发也越来越受到人们的关注。本文将介绍厦门APP开发中常见的问题,包括开发流程、技术选型、安全性等方面。一、开发流程1. 需求分析:在开发APP前,首先需要明确APP的目标
2024-01-10
app要开发一个多少钱
开发一个应用程序所需的费用是一个相对复杂的问题,因为它涉及到多个因素,包括应用的复杂度、所需的功能、设计要求等等。在这篇文章中,我们将详细介绍应用程序开发的原理和相关的费用因素。应用程序开发的原理:1. 需求分析:在开发应用程序之前,第一步是明确应用程序的
2023-07-14
app应用开发的好选择
在进行app应用开发时,选择一个适合的开发框架是非常重要的。一个好的开发框架可以大大提高开发效率,简化开发流程,同时也可以提供丰富的功能和良好的用户体验。下面我将介绍几个在app应用开发中的好选择。1. React NativeReact Native是由
2023-07-14
app派单开发思路
一、概述随着互联网的发展,各类在线服务如雨后春笋般涌现,而派单服务也是其中之一。派单服务指的是通过一个平台,将用户的需求与服务提供者进行匹配,并将任务派发给合适的服务提供者。这种服务模式在各个领域都有应用,如外卖送餐、快递配送、家政服务等。二、派单开发思路
2023-06-29
app开发市场的未来发展会怎样
随着智能手机的普及和移动互联网的快速发展,应用程序(App)开发市场正迅速增长,并且在未来有着巨大的发展潜力。本文将从技术、市场和用户需求等方面详细介绍App开发市场的未来发展。一、技术趋势1. 人工智能(AI):随着人工智能技术的不断进步,AI将成为Ap
2023-06-29
APP制作是什么意思?
使用這些軟體制作APP的缺點是功能和設計可能受到限制,您可能無法完全自定義您想要的效果和細節,也可能無法解決一些技術上的問題和錯誤。因此,如果您想要更高度的自由度和彈性,您可能需要學習使用原生或跨平台的APP開發工具,例如Xcode、Android Studio、React Native等。這些工具需要您具備一定的程式設計能力和知識,讓您可以使用程式語言和代碼來控制APP的邏輯、資料和介面。
2023-03-28